No, no, no! It USED to be that at supper Cindy was the only princess, but that was changed back in February. All meals now have the princesses come around to the tables.

Per All Ears:
--As of February 7, 2010, Dinner at Cinderella's Royal Table features the same characters as the Breakfast and Lunch character meals at the restaurant. When you arrive at the restaurant, Cinderella will welcome you to her castle in the lobby. At that time, she will pose for photos and sign autographs, then you will proceed upstairs to dine with other characters from Disney's Royal Family. (Characters subject to change without notice.)
